For most mattresses, having something between the mattress itself and the floor is helpful. Whether this should be a box spring, a foundation, or a platform bed depends on several factors. All mattresses will benefit from having a firm, solid foundation to rest on. Box springs were created to help absorb impact, reducing the wear and tear on the mattress. However, box springs were more prevalent when mattresses had much thinner profiles overall, and were primarily innerspring designs. Today, most modern mattresses do not necessarily require a box spring. Determining whether it’s better to sleep with or without a box spring depends on a few factors. The main people that should use a box spring include: Those using a traditional metal rail bed frame, which is designed to cradle box springs Those with an older innerspring mattress designed for use with a box spring

They function similarly to box springs, but they don’t actually contain metal springs. Foundations offer a very firm surface for mattresses to rest on, making them a good choice for foam beds. Most foundations are designed to be used with a bed frame, although some companies offer free-standing versions. A platform bed combines both a foundation for your bed as well as a frame to keep it off the ground. Most have wooden legs to elevate the frame, while some include storage drawers reaching down to the ground level. Platform beds offer an all-in-one solution, but they can be pricier than other options. An adjustable bed is a foundation that can be adjusted to various positions, similar to a hospital bed. These are a great option for those who like to read or watch TV in bed, and older individuals who struggle to get out of bed in the morning.
